Matomo analytics database: migrating from MySQL to MariaDB

Contents

Ready to use in minutes, Matomo gives you:
✔ Accurate privacy-first analytics
✔ Full data ownership
✔ GDPR compliance

This short blog post is an announcement regarding the Matomo (Piwik) technology stack.

Matomo compatible with MySQL and MariaDB

Since our first public release Matomo uses the open source database server MySQL to store the analytics data.

Matomo is also compatible with MariaDB. MariaDB is an enhanced, drop-in replacement for MySQL.

Upgrading to MariaDB

Many users from our community as well as Matomo Scalability Experts have confirmed that using MariaDB for Matomo has several advantages. MariaDB has in some cases significantly improved query performance and reliability of Matomo. Because MariaDB 5.5 is a complete drop-in-replacement for MySQL 5.5, upgrading can be as easy as running apt-get install mariadb-server (or equivalent for your platform). Existing third party techologies such as TokuDB (FAQ) and Galera are fully compatible with MariaDB.

Learn more about upgrading to MariaDB: Upgrading from MySQL to MariaDB

In the future, Matomo will stay compatible with both MySQL and MariaDB.

Get started with Matomo

By choosing Matomo, the ethical analytics alternative, you won’t make privacy sacrifices or compromise your site.

Enjoyed this post?
Join the 160,000+ subscribers who receive the Matomo Newsletter straight to their inbox every month

Subscribe to our newsletter to receive regular information about Matomo. You can unsubscribe at any time from it. This service uses SendGrid. Learn more about it within our privacy Policy page.

Certifié ISO 27001:2022

Vos données analytics sont protégées par des standards de sécurité reconnus à l’international. La certification ISO 27001 garantit que nous appliquons les plus hauts standards de gestion de la sécurité de l’information.

Sites web en ligne à travers le monde
0 K
de sites web ont utilisé Matomo
0 M
de satisfaction client
0 %

Gardez le contrôle de vos données. Respectez la vie privée de vos utilisateurs. Accédez à des analyses plus performantes.

Les organisations devraient pouvoir comprendre leurs performances numériques tout en conservant la pleine propriété et le contrôle de leurs données.

Aucune carte bancaire requise.